Alt + V for Paste Special in MS Word

Want to use Alt + V for Paste Special in MS Word? Piece of cake!

Follow the steps below:

  1. Click on Tools | Macro | Macros.
  2. The Macros dialog box will display.
  3. In the Macro name box, key in PasteUnformattedText.
  4. Make sure that All active templates and documents is displayed in the Macros in list, and then click Create.
  5. The Microsoft Visual Basic Editor is displayed.
  6. Directly above the End Sub statement in the PasteUnformattedText subroutine, key in the following:
  7. Selection,PasteSpecial DataType:=wdPasteText.
  8. On the File menu, click Close and Return to Microsoft Word.

Now you need to tell MS Word to run the PasteUnformattedText macro each time you click on Alt + V.

  1. Click on Tools | Customize.
  2. Click the Keyboard button.
  3. Make sure the Save changes in box displays the Normal.dot.
  4. In the Categories list, click Macros.
  5. In the Macros list, click PasteUnformattedText.
  6. Click in the Press new shortcut key box.
  7. Click Alt + V simultaneously.
  8. Click Assign.
  9. Click Close and then Close again.

That's it! You're done!

Color Even Numbered Rows in a List in MS Excel!

Want to color your even numbered rows in your MS Excel List? Follow the steps below:

  1. Select a cell in the region and click Ctrl + Shift +* or Ctrl + A t select the Current Region.
  2. From the Format menu, select Conditional Formatting.
  3. For Condition 1, select Formula is and insert the following formula in the Formula box:
  4. =MOD(ROW(),2<>0
  5. Click Format and select the Patterns tab.
  6. Choose any color and click OK two times.
